Namibia - Export of Percussion Musical Instruments

Since 2014, Namibia Export of Percussion Musical Instruments was down by 35.5% year on year. At $7,867.16 in 2019, the country was ranked number 97 among other countries in Export of Percussion Musical Instruments. Namibia is overtaken by Bolivia, which was number 96 with $7,995.14 and is followed by Tunisia with $7,008.04. China ranked the highest with $133,780,114.51 in 2019, that is an increase of 0% compared to 2018. United States, Germany and Netherlands resp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Tanzania recorded the best 5 years average growth at +459.6% per year, while Kyrgyzstan recorded the worst performance at -86.5% per year.
